I recently installed SBS 2003 and when Itried to open "Admin Tools" I found out I couldn't. After much research and not alot of results the computer finally told me what was wrong. Here is what it has to say:

The controller "name" ia a domain controller. This "snap-in" cannot be used on a domain controller. Domain controllers are managed with Active Directory users and computers "snap-in".

Basically the only thing I'm trying to do but can't is access Admin Tools. Is there a way to fix this problem without re-installing the OS or maybe I can access this system remotely and do what I have to do like any admin type chores?

SBS should be configured with the wizards, so simply open the Server management snap-in in your Start menu.
